GE Aerospace Advanced Lead Design Engineer at Integrated Manufacturing Engineering – Rotating Parts and Compressor Airfoils in Queretaro, Mexico

Job Description Summary

This position is for an Advanced Lead Design Engineer within the Integrated Manufacturing Engineering (IME) organization. In this role you will own all engineering functions related to the production of rotating parts and compressor airfoils made by GE shops and external suppliers.

In this role, you will be on the front lines of an organization that is dedicated to improving the delivery and producibility, enhancing the Engineering-Supply chain relationship to improve the health of the supply chain and product to enable the business to fulfil our customers' expectations.

Examples of specific tasks you will be responsible for are: producibility design changes, on-going manufacturing support, and strategic improvements on production related processes of the assigned hardware.
